Supply & Demand Chain Executive Honors LogicSource Leader, Erik Given, in the 2025 Pros to Know Awards
WESTPORT, Conn., March 18,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- LogicSource, the leader in procurement services and technology solutions, proudly announces that Erik Given, managing director of its distribution and logistics sourcing practice, is recognized in the 2025 Pros to Know Awards by Supply & Demand Chain Executive. This award honors outstanding executives whose accomplishments offer a roadmap for other leaders looking to use supply chain for competitive advantage. Given's recognition is part of the Leaders in Excellence category, which honors forward-thinkers who have made significant industry contributions. Given is a distribution and logistics veteran with 35 years of experience leading best practices for organizations, including Heineken, MillerCoors, and Sysco. At LogicSource, he has played a pivotal role in helping clients build more resilient supply chains and enabling more substantial financial and operational outcomes. Nulogy's Kevin Wong Recognized in 2025 Pros to Know by Supply & Demand Chain Executive
Nulogy co-founder and COO leads the way in solving complex supply chain challenges TORONTO, March 17, 2025 /PRNewswire/ - Nulogy, a leader in collaborative manufacturing and supply chain solutions, is pleased to announce that Kevin Wong, Chief Operating Officer, has been recognized by Supply & Demand Chain Executive as a recipient of this year's Pros to Know award. This award recognizes outstanding executives whose accomplishments offer a roadmap for other leaders looking to leverage supply chains for competitive advantage. This recognition is for the Leaders in Excellence category. As COO and co-founder of Nulogy, Kevin has been a driving force behind the company's product vision and strategy, shaping purpose-built solutions that address the unique challenges of complex multi-enterprise supply chains. With deep expertise in both technology and supply chain collaboration, Kevin has been instrumental in helping Nulogy's customers—including brand manufacturers such as Colgate-Palmolive, L'Oréal and Church & Dwight—gain the visibility and agility needed to thrive in today's dynamic markets. Kevin's influence extends beyond Nulogy, as an active contributor to the broader supply chain community through his involvement in trusted industry organizations such as the Foundation for Supply Chain Solutions, the Visibility Council and Association for Supply Chain Management. With a recent focus on integrating new manufacturing productivity capabilities into Nulogy's platform through its Smart Factory solution, Kevin is committed to evolving a product offering that not only delivers real-time data visibility, but also creates shared value for all partners in an external manufacturing network. Kevin Coleman, Brad Nuffer Named "Pros to Know" by Supply & Demand Chain Executive
DES PLAINES, Ill., March 17, 2025--(BUSINESS WIRE)--CJ Logistics America announced today that CEO Kevin Coleman and Senior Vice President of Transportation Operations Brad Nuffer have both been named to Supply & Demand Chain Executive magazine's annual "Pros to Know" list. The Pros to Know award recognizes outstanding executives whose accomplishments offer a roadmap for other leaders looking to leverage the supply chain for competitive advantages. Coleman was honored in the "Leaders in Excellence" category, and Nuffer won in the "Top Transportation Innovators" category. This is the second award that Coleman and Nuffer have won already this year, both having been named to Food Logistics' Rock Stars of the Supply Chain list in February. A. Duie Pyle's Craig Lough Named to Supply & Demand Chain Executive's 2025 Pros to Know List
Pyle's strategic planning director honored for driving growth and innovation in brokerage division WEST CHESTER, Pa., March 17,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- A. Duie Pyle (Pyle), a premier 100-year-old, family-owned and operated provider of asset and non-asset-based supply chain solutions, today announces that Craig Lough, director of strategic planning, has been named a recipient of the 2025 Pros to Know award by Supply & Demand Chain Executive in the Top Transportation Innovators category. The Pros to Know award recognizes outstanding individuals and true pioneers of change across the industry, whose accomplishments offer a roadmap for other leaders. Lough has been instrumental in the development and execution of Pyle's operational strategy, driving innovative business growth that delivers superior value to customers through Pyle's brokerage division. Lough demonstrates his commitment and expertise each day, as he balances time between managing his internal team, meeting with current customers and securing new business. When Lough first joined Pyle, he immersed himself in researching, designing and implementing the relaunch of the company's brokerage division. This led to him spearheading the development of a completely new commercial go-to-market strategy. His efforts secured significant results, seeing 39% year-over-year growth, despite the economic downturn that followed COVID. Following the brokerage division's relaunch, Lough was appointed head of the new business unit, which includes two offices in West Chester and Mechanicsburg, PA.
